Description

It's Time to Take "Shopping Local" to the Next Level!

Welcome back to the Nineties. Canada’s music scene is rocking, and the store shelves are packed with winners, if you're ready to roll. In Operation CanCon, you’re not just flipping through dusty bins, you’re chasing priceless cultural artifacts. As a lone collector on a mission, your goal is to target a checklist of tracks scattered in iconic Toronto shops.

Part interactive fiction, part solo roll-and-write game, every visit is a gamble, whether for ten minutes or a campaign. All you need to play is three six-sided dice and something to write with.

Operation CanCon is your passport to an era of gone-but-unforgettable Canadian Content. The music that inspired a generation is ready to rise again, but it needs YOU to bring the decade back to life. Fully steeped in nostalgia, this standalone sequel to the Eighties original lets you relive a time when finding the right album seemed like fate.

—description from the designer
